Bev Miller Named Johns Creek Rotary President
Bev Miller was named the club's president for the 2014-15 club year.

The Rotary Club of Johns Creek – North Fulton inducted Bev Miller as the club’s president for 2014-2015 on July 9.
Miller, director of community relations at Emory Johns Creek Hospital, is a charter member of the club, which meets on Wednesdays at the Atlanta Athletic Club.

“I’m proud of what our club has accomplished since chartering last year,” Miller said. “Our priority is to serve the Johns Creek community and I’m looking forward to continuing that mission this year. We have some great service projects and events planned in the coming months.”
The Rotary Club of Johns Creek – North Fulton 2014-2015 board of directors also includes: Ron Jones, president-elect; Mike Kopp, past president; Shirley House, treasurer; Nicole Lawson, secretary; Glenn Spears, Rotary Foundation; Jennifer Chapman, public relations; Dan McKenzie, service projects; Mary King, membership; Rich Tatgenhorst, sergeant at arms; Trudy Provo, administration.

The Rotary Club of Johns Creek – North Fulton meets on Wednesdays at noon at the Atlanta Athletic Club.
